BA22 9NE is a quiet, settled residential neighbourhood on Holywell, 0.2km from Burton in South Somerset. Administratively it sits within Coker ward and the Yeovil constituency.

One of the more sought-after postcodes in BA22, BA22 9NE offers a quiet rural community with low density and high home ownership. The daytime character shifts — mainly white older workforce, self-employed in agriculture, forestry and fishing, with some construction. Average age 56 — this is a predominantly retired and pre-retirement community, with very low mobility and high owner-occupation. 85% of residents own their home — above average for the district, consistent with a stable and sought-after address.

Safety: Crime rates are low here at 3 incidents per 1,000 residents — well below average and reassuring for families. Property: Prices average £485k.

Census 2021 statistics for BA22 9NE are sourced from Output Area E00148638 (shared with 38 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
